WebDec 11, 2024 · To do that, go to the Network Storage module and click the Add button. Expand the Protocol drop-down list and select Amazon S3. Click OK to proceed. Once the network storage parameters dialog appears, give this network storage a name, say, 'ns-s3'. After that, enter your AWS S3 access key and its corresponding secret key. WebDec 8, 2024 · Added as a public preview in ONTAP 9.7, S3 is now a fully supported protocol in ONTAP 9.8. Support for S3 includes the following: Basic PUT/GET object access (does not include access to both S3 and NAS from the same bucket) No object tagging or ILM support; for feature-rich, globally dispersed S3, use NetApp StorageGRID.
